Paul Davis wrote:

>>Doesn't ardour allow this type of binding midi CC's to mixer controls?
>
>
> indeed, it does. and as other posters have noted, the method used is
> to have the GUI as an intermediary only for the binding: when you
> start the binding process, its done using a GUI (View/Controller) object, and so when
> the MIDI data arrives, the GUI hands off the MIDI data to the Model
> object represented by the GUI object. the binding is made between
> Model objects and MIDI, not GUI objects and MIDI, even though it is
> initiated at the GUI leve.
>
> subsequent MIDI data (corresponding to what was bound) is sent
> directly to the Model, not the GUI (View/Controller). The GUI is
> updated when/if the Model changes state in response to the incoming MIDI.
